Earnings from Gold Rush

Being a cast member on a popular reality show like 'Gold Rush' definitely comes with a paycheck. While Juan Ibarra's specific salary for 'Gold Rush' isn't publicly detailed, we can look at some benchmarks. For instance, there was discussion about what Freddy Dodge and Juan might be getting paid per episode for 'Mine Rescue.' Some thought it could be around $50,000 a piece, with others suggesting Freddy might get $50,000 and Juan around $25,000 per episode. This gives us, you know, a rough idea of the kind of money involved for key figures on these shows.

If Juan was earning even $25,000 per episode, and considering he was on the show since 2015, those earnings would add up significantly over multiple seasons. What Happened to Juan Ibarra on Gold Rush?

Fans of 'Gold Rush' might have noticed Juan Ibarra's absence in later seasons. According to information available, Juan Ibarra was not invited back for season 11 of the show. This can be a bit of a surprise for viewers who were used to seeing his expertise on screen. The reasons for cast changes on reality television shows are, you know, varied and not always fully disclosed to the public.

Sometimes, it's about new directions for the show, or perhaps, in some cases, it's simply a business decision by the production company.
